Show that $\displaystyle\sum^{\infty}_{n=1}\frac{(-1)^n}{n}$ converges.
Hint: consider the sum of two subsequent entries.

Hint: $1/n - 1/(n+1) = 1/[n(n+1)].$ That shows that if you group this series in pairs, it converges (by the comparison test). You still have some work left to do.
